Replaced battery and alternator and truck won't
start.tbe starter is fine.on battery gauge is showing
low charge.....so my question is what to check now

1 Answer

73,320

If it will not jump start or fire at all ask yourself if the fuel filter has been changed in 17 years. You can also check for fuel pressure at the rail. A gauge will cost 20 bucks at an auto store. If fuel pressure is ok you can move on to injectors, coil, plug wires, plugs, and so forth.
